In a reflection of Beijing’s ability to quickly leverage its dominance over the critical-mineral supply chain, the value of rare earth elements exported by China last month plunged by nearly half compared with a year prior. The official data came as analysts have been saying that China’s export controls over large quantities of critical minerals are like the ultimate trump card in trade negotiations with the United States.
